US Stock Market Sees Significant Decline Amid Economic Concerns

The US stock market experienced a pronounced downturn on Thursday, as investors grappled with heightened valuations within the artificial intelligence realm and emerging indications of fragility in the US labor market.

The Dow Jones Industrial Average plummeted by 399 points, or 0.84%, concluding the day at 46,912. The S&P 500 recorded a descent of 1.12%, settling at 6,720, while the tech-oriented Nasdaq Composite suffered a steep fall of 1.9%, closing at 23,054. Notably, the Nasdaq 100 is currently poised for its most dismal week since early April.

Declines were predominantly seen in major technology firms, with Nvidia, Microsoft, Palantir Technologies, Broadcom, and AMD leading the charge downward. AMD alone fell by 7%, as robust earnings reports were insufficient to allay future demand anxieties.

Palantir and Oracle faced declines of 7% and 3%, respectively, while Qualcomm experienced a near 4% drop despite promising quarterly results, following warnings regarding potential losses in business with Apple. Nvidia and Meta also concluded the day in the red.

Valuation Pressures and Investor Hesitation

Numerous substantial technology entities remain under duress as investors reevaluate inflated valuations and constricted profit forecasts.

Analysts highlighted a significant divergence between firms that are raising projections and those presenting weaker outlooks, exacerbating volatility across the sector.

Citigroup remarked that stretched valuations necessitate sustained earnings momentum and affirmative guidance to uphold current market levels.

Jobs Data Amplifies Economic Anxieties

Recent revelations indicate a concerning surge in layoffs. October witnessed job cuts exceeding 153,000—nearly threefold the figures from September, and 175% higher than last year, rendering it the most challenging October in two decades.

Analysts suggest that these statistics, combined with a government closure now extending into its second month, depict a precarious landscape for the US economy.

Market participants remain hopeful that, upon government reopening, consumer resilience during the holiday season may foster a stabilization of sentiment in the latter part of the year.

Declining Treasury yields signal increasing expectations for a Federal Reserve interest rate reduction in December. The CME FedWatch Tool now indicates a 68.9% probability, rising from 62% the previous day. Analysts predict further policy support should labor data continue to weaken.

Consumer discretionary sectors led a downturn across six of the eleven S&P sectors, with Nvidia falling above 2% and Tesla declining by 3% ahead of a pivotal shareholder vote regarding Elon Musk’s $US1 trillion remuneration package.

Australian Market Anticipates Lower Opening

SPI futures forecast a 0.16% decrease to 8831. Macquarie is set to unveil its full-year results, while quarterly updates are expected from News Corp, REA Group, and Block. Annual meetings for Nine Entertainment, Amcor, and Qantas are also on the agenda.
